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This report summarizes subsistence harvest information on seabirds and their eggs in Alaska. This report is part of a larger effort to summarize information on subsistence seabird harvest activities in eight arctic circumpolar countries under the auspices of the multilateral agreement called the Arctic Environmental Protection Strategy. In accordance with the Migratory Bird Treaty Act it is legal for Eskimos and Indians to harvest 20 species of seabirds in Alaska. The estimated annual harvest of seabirds and their eggs in Alaska is 7,222 and 45,071, respectively. Most seabirds and eggs are harvested in the Bering Sea region. The most commonly harvested seabird groups are murres and auklets, which together represent about 72% of the total subsistence bird harvest in Alaska.
